Who are carers?

Carers provide unpaid care and support to ill, frail or disabled friends or family members.

People from all walks of life and backgrounds are carers - over 3 in 5 people in the UK will become carers at some time in their lives. Caring can be a rewarding experience, yet many face isolation, poverty, discrimination and ill-health.
